A fact-finding report, released by rights group Anhad, has accused authorities of watching over sectarian clashes in Maharshtra’s Dhule, in which six youths, all of them Muslims, were killed in police firing on January 6.
HT Image
Survivors said the police’s actions were biased against the minority community.
HT could not independently check with the state police for its version.
Apoorvanand, a Delhi University professor and member of the team, said eye-witnesses had testified that the police provided cover for a Hindu mob, which then plundered through a Muslim locality.
The mission was led by activist Shabnam Hashmi.
Nazneen, a local woman, alleged deputy SP Monika Rawat had “pressured her” to avoid helping a public inquiry.
